Print, "The demon of the plague," Illustration for "Paradise and the Peri" by Thomas Moore published in "Lalla Rookh: An Oriental Romance" (Estes & Lauriat, 1885, p. 123)

This is a Print. It was after Kenyon Cox. It is dated 1884 and we acquired it in 1959. It is a part of the Drawings, Prints, and Graphic Design department.

This object was donated by Allyn Cox. It is credited Gift of Allyn Cox.

It is signed

Signed in print, lower right: Kenyon Cox - 84 -
